re PR middle-end/7651 (Define -Wextra strictly in terms of other warning flags)
authorManuel López-Ibáñez <manu@gcc.gnu.org>
Sun, 20 May 2007 00:45:58 +0000 (00:45 +0000)
committerManuel López-Ibáñez <manu@gcc.gnu.org>
Sun, 20 May 2007 00:45:58 +0000 (00:45 +0000)
commitffd5f2761323eea74743302bfdbff644eceae83b
treebbcc1e2ae00d84751fb6d9e0d94ad59c5dd5ae75
parent05ce201275137ae82ced2edc32c43acf9fea37d7
re PR middle-end/7651 (Define -Wextra strictly in terms of other warning flags)

2006-05-20  Manuel Lopez-Ibanez  <manu@gcc.gnu.org>

PR middle-end/7651
* doc/invoke.texi (Wreturn-type): Complete description.
(Wextra): Delete item about return-type warning.
* c-decl.c: Delete redundant Wextra warning.

testsuite/
* gcc.dg/20030906-1.c: Replace Wextra with Wreturn-type.
* gcc.dg/20030906-2.c: Likewise.
* objc.dg/method-17.m: Add -Wreturn-type.
* obj-c++.dg/method-21.mm: Likewise.

From-SVN: r124866
gcc/ChangeLog
gcc/c-decl.c
gcc/doc/invoke.texi
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/20030906-1.c
gcc/testsuite/gcc.dg/20030906-2.c
gcc/testsuite/obj-c++.dg/method-21.mm
gcc/testsuite/objc.dg/method-17.m